Roof pitch calculator
Turn a roof's rise and run into an angle, a percentage and an X:12 pitch.

What does a typical calculation look like?
With Rise (cm) = 30 and Run (cm) = 100, the calculator returns Angle (°) = 16.699, Slope (%) = 30% and Pitch (x-in-12) = 3.6. Those figures come from running this exact tool, so you can reproduce them by entering the same values.

What is the most common mistake?
Ordering the exact calculated quantity. Every material loses some of itself between the pallet and the finished job — offcuts, breakage, a bag that sets, a coat that soaks in further than the datasheet says — so add the allowance yours asks for, and order it in one delivery: a second batch rarely matches the first.
